How Commercial Water Removal Works in Fairport, NY
When water damage occurs, it’s essential to act quickly to prevent further damage and mold growth. Our team will arrive at your property within 60 minutes of your call, equipped with the necessary equipment to assess the situation and develop a customized plan to restore your property. Our technicians will use advanced equipment, such as water extraction machines and drying equipment, to remove standing water and dry out affected areas. We’ll also use thermal imaging cameras to detect any hidden moisture that might be causing damage.
Assessment and Inspection
We’ll conduct a thorough assessment of your property to find out the extent of the damage, identifying the source of the water and the affected areas. Our team will use specialized equipment to detect any hidden moisture, mold, or structural damage.
Identify the source of the water damage
Assess the affected areas
Develop a customized plan for restoration
Water Extraction
Using high-powered water extraction machines, our technicians will remove standing water from your property, including carpets, upholstery, and hard floors. This is a critical step in preventing further damage and mold growth.
Remove standing water from affected areas
Use water extraction machines to dry carpets and upholstery
Ensure all affected areas are dry and free of moisture
Drying and Dehumidification
Once the water has been extracted, our technicians will use drying equipment, such as air blowers and dehumidifiers, to dry out affected areas. This process can take several days to complete, depending on the severity of the damage.
Use air blowers to dry out affected areas
Deploy dehumidifiers to remove excess moisture
Monitor the drying process to ensure it’s completed correctly
Mold Remediation
If mold growth is detected, our technicians will use specialized equipment and cleaning solutions to remediate the affected areas. This process involves cleaning and disinfecting the surfaces, as well as removing any damaged materials.
Identify and contain mold growth
Use specialized equipment to remediate affected areas
Remove any damaged materials and replace them with new ones
Final Inspection and Cleaning
Once the restoration process is complete, our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ure that all affected areas are dry, clean, and free of moisture. We’ll also provide you with guidance on how to prevent future water damage and maintain your property.

Commercial Water Removal v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small leak in a bathroom | Yes | No | DIY solutions, such as a bucket and towels, can handle small leaks. |
| Flooding in a commercial property | No | Yes | Commercial water removal needs specialized equipment and expertise to prevent further damage and mold growth. |
| Water damage in a crawl space | No | Yes | Water damage in crawl spaces can be difficult to access and needs specialized equipment to remove standing water and dry out affected areas. |
| Musty odors in a property | No | Yes | Musty odors can be a sign of hidden moisture or mold growth, which needs professional remediation to prevent health risks. |
| Water damage in a property with a septic system | No | Yes | Water damage in properties with septic systems needs specialized equipment and expertise to prevent contamination and health risks. |
| Discoloration or fading of carpets or upholstery | No | Yes | Discoloration or fading of carpets or upholstery can show water damage or excessive moisture, which needs professional cleaning and remediation. |
